QQ扫一扫联系
如何利用 Laravel 源码题库组卷进行在线考试的安全防护
随着在线考试的普及,考试安全成为了教育和培训机构关注的重要问题。为了保护考试的公平性和数据的安全性,利用 Laravel 源码题库组卷功能来实现在线考试的安全防护是至关重要的。本文将介绍如何利用 Laravel 源码题库组卷来实施安全防护措施,以确保在线考试的安全性和可信度。
在线考试系统涉及到大量的敏感数据,包括学生信息、题目和答案等。为了保护这些数据的安全性,可以利用 Laravel 提供的加密功能,对数据进行加密处理。同时,通过使用安全的数据传输协议(如 HTTPS)来加密数据传输,防止数据被恶意截获或篡改。
在在线考试系统中,用户认证和授权是防止未经授权访问的关键。利用 Laravel 提供的身份验证和权限管理功能,可以确保只有经过身份验证和授权的用户才能参与考试和访问相关数据。通过设定角色和权限,可以精确控制用户的操作范围和权限级别,从而保护考试系统的安全。
在线考试系统容易成为恶意攻击的目标,如跨站脚本攻击(XSS)和SQL注入攻击等。为了防止这些攻击,可以利用 Laravel 提供的安全防护措施。例如,使用 Laravel 的 Blade 模板引擎可以自动对输出进行转义,防止XSS攻击。此外,利用 Laravel 的查询构造器和预处理语句等功能,可以防止SQL注入攻击。
在线考试系统应该记录关键操作和事件的日志,以便进行安全审计和故障排查。Laravel 提供了强大的日志记录功能,可以记录用户的操作、异常事件和系统错误等。通过监控日志,可以及时发现异常行为和潜在的安全威胁,并采取相应的应对措施。
定期进行安全漏洞扫描和更新管理是保持在线考试系统安全的重要步骤。及时更新 Laravel 框架和相关插件,以获取最新的安全补丁和修复漏洞。同时,定期进行安全漏洞扫描和渗透测试,以发现潜在的安全漏洞,并及时采取修复措施。
利用 Laravel 源码题库组卷功能,我们可以实现在线考试系统的安全防护。通过数据加密和传输安全、用户认证和授权、防止恶意攻击和注入攻击、日志和监控以及安全漏洞扫描和更新管理,可以确保在线考试的安全性和可信度。希望本文的指导能帮助教育和培训机构构建更安全、可靠的在线考试环境,保护考试的公平性和数据的安全性。